Output b0f59bbe42aef24db63b12ffebee903a656ac27cc1e60c6a02bc72b6c2364d68:0

value
17980259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8917b066a87861842750e9b14076f672dede09d OP_EQUAL
address
3JWvY1PasSwQqHzR5qiyU8KsEZT2GpNhEh
transaction
b0f59bbe42aef24db63b12ffebee903a656ac27cc1e60c6a02bc72b6c2364d68
spent
true